Objective
Mastery of operations models typical of the professional field, working life skills, and the development of tasks related to one's own work. The assignments support the implementation of students' personal study plans and the objectives of the diploma in higher education.
Content
Before starting the internship, the student completes the tasks related to the internship and job seeking on the course Development as an Expert.
Contents:
Knowledge-based CV
Portfolio in LinkedIn
Networking plan
After practical training: Report and presentation
During the internship, the student does work assignments in their field. The tasks are defined in the internship agreement. The student also writes the learning objectives in the agreement.
Student workload
You will receive 5 ECTS credits after completing work assignments suitable for your own profession in the internship for about a month, 135 hours. You can include the time it takes to write a practical training report to those hours.
Assessment criteria, approved/failed
Qualitative assessment reflects on competence objectives and student self-assessment plays an important role in it. Learning outcomes are assessed in relation to the learning goals of the internship.
The student is eligible for the credits after concluding an internship agreement, completing an internship, writing a report and presenting their experiences
for other students doing the diploma in higher education.
